Subject: [PATCH 4/4] can: c_can: Add d_can suspend resume support
Date: Mon, 3 Sep 2012 17:22:19 +0530	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<1346673139-14540-5-git-send-email-anilkumar@ti.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<1346673139-14540-1-git-send-email-anilkumar@ti.com>

Adds suspend resume support to DCAN driver which enables
DCAN power down mode bit (PDR). Then DCAN will ack the local
power-down mode by setting PDA bit in STATUS register.

Also adds a status flag to know the status of DCAN module,
whether it is opened or not.

+#ifdef CONFIG_PM
+int c_can_power_down(struct net_device *dev)
+{
+	unsigned long time_out;
+	struct c_can_priv *priv = netdev_priv(dev);
+
+	if (!priv->is_opened)
+		return 0;
+
+	/* set `PDR` value so the device goes to power down mode */
+	priv->write_reg(priv, C_CAN_CTRL_EX_REG,
+		priv->read_reg(priv, C_CAN_CTRL_EX_REG) | CONTROL_EX_PDR);
+
+	/* Wait for the PDA bit to get set */
+	time_out = jiffies + msecs_to_jiffies(INIT_WAIT_COUNT);
+	while (!(priv->read_reg(priv, C_CAN_STS_REG) & STATUS_PDA) &&
+				time_after(time_out, jiffies))
+		cpu_relax();
+
+	if (time_after(jiffies, time_out))
+		return -ETIMEDOUT;
+
+	c_can_stop(dev);
+
+	/* De-initialize DCAN RAM */
+	c_can_reset_ram(priv, false);
+	c_can_pm_runtime_put_sync(priv);
+
+	return 0;
+}
+E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(c_can_power_down);
+
+int c_can_power_up(struct net_device *dev)
+{
+	unsigned long time_out;
+	struct c_can_priv *priv = netdev_priv(dev);
+
+	if (!priv->is_opened)
+		return 0;
+
+	c_can_pm_runtime_get_sync(priv);
+	/* Initialize DCAN RAM */
+	c_can_reset_ram(priv, true);
+
+	/* Clear PDR and INIT bits */
+	priv->write_reg(priv, C_CAN_CTRL_EX_REG,
+		priv->read_reg(priv, C_CAN_CTRL_EX_REG) & ~CONTROL_EX_PDR);
+	priv->write_reg(priv, C_CAN_CTRL_REG,
+		priv->read_reg(priv, C_CAN_CTRL_REG) & ~CONTROL_INIT);
+
+	/* Wait for the PDA bit to get clear */
+	time_out = jiffies + msecs_to_jiffies(INIT_WAIT_COUNT);
+	while ((priv->read_reg(priv, C_CAN_STS_REG) & STATUS_PDA) &&
+				time_after(time_out, jiffies))
+		cpu_relax();
+
+	if (time_after(jiffies, time_out))
+		return -ETIMEDOUT;
+
+	c_can_start(dev);
+
+	return 0;
+}
+E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(c_can_power_up);
+#else
+#define c_can_power_down NULL
+#define c_can_power_up NULL
+#endif

+#ifdef CONFIG_PM
+static int c_can_suspend(struct platform_device *pdev, pm_message_t state)
+{
+	int ret;
+	struct net_device *ndev = platform_get_drvdata(pdev);
+	struct c_can_priv *priv = netdev_priv(ndev);
+	const struct platform_device_id *id = platform_get_device_id(pdev);
+
+	if (id->driver_data != BOSCH_D_CAN) {
+		dev_warn(&pdev->dev, "Not supported\n");
+		return 0;
+	}
+
+	if (netif_running(ndev)) {
+		netif_stop_queue(ndev);
+		netif_device_detach(ndev);
+	}
+
+	ret = c_can_power_down(ndev);
+	if (ret) {
+		dev_err(&pdev->dev, "failed to enter power down mode\n");
+		return ret;
+	}
+
+	priv->can.state = CAN_STATE_SLEEPING;
+
+	return 0;
+}
+
+static int c_can_resume(struct platform_device *pdev)
+{
+	int ret;
+
+	struct net_device *ndev = platform_get_drvdata(pdev);
+	struct c_can_priv *priv = netdev_priv(ndev);
+	const struct platform_device_id *id = platform_get_device_id(pdev);
+
+	if (id->driver_data != BOSCH_D_CAN) {
+		dev_warn(&pdev->dev, "Not supported\n");
+		return 0;
+	}
+
+	ret = c_can_power_up(ndev);
+	if (ret) {
+		dev_err(&pdev->dev, "Still in power down mode\n");
+		return ret;
+	}
+
+	priv->can.state = CAN_STATE_ERROR_ACTIVE;
+
+	if (netif_running(ndev)) {
+		netif_device_attach(ndev);
+		netif_start_queue(ndev);
+	}
+
+	return 0;
+}
+#else
+#define c_can_suspend NULL
+#define c_can_resume NULL
+#endif
